When the dining rooms were designed, it was with the understand that it would be more cruise-traditional SHARED TABLES and there was more than 2 feet of space between them. The more people have demanded they get their own table, the closer the tables have gotten to each other.

My vote is to use the space to create non-cruise ship type dining rooms, where regardless of party size, you won't be expected to share tables with strangers. Many people are demanding separate tables anyway- might as well make proper room for them.

The reason that the ships leave CC when they do is due to distance from PC. The ships are due back in port for turnaround between 530 and 6 and its a 12 hour run from CC to the pier, and at least that long to offload and load fresh equipment and food, and stores for the next trip. It usually takes 6 or 8 hours alone to take on fuel. The bug situation is handled naturally, the same way they do at most of the parks. They plant stuff bugs don't like. And use other natural bugs that keep the mosquitos and things down and almost non existant.
